How AI Photo Finder Technology Helps

An AI photo finder uses visual signals, metadata, and smart indexing to connect people with the photos they care about. Instead of browsing manually, users can start with a face match, event identifier, or filtered gallery view.

For photographers, this approach saves support time. Instead of replying to dozens of messages like "Where are my photos?" you share one branded search page and let the system do the heavy lifting.

For attendees, AI search feels natural. They upload a reference selfie or use the provided flow and quickly receive the most relevant matches. This is the same expectation users already have from modern search engines.

Step-by-Step Workflow for Better Results

Start with clean event organization. Name each event clearly, keep galleries separated, and publish only the final set. Quality input improves search quality.

Next, make discovery obvious. Add clear instructions at the top of your event gallery explaining how to find wedding photos or event portraits with AI. A short instruction block can reduce confusion immediately.

Then optimize for mobile behavior. Most people search right after the event from their phone. Fast loading, simple prompts, and large action buttons make a huge difference in completion rates.

Face Recognition Photo Search Best Practices

Face recognition photo search works best when images are sharp, well exposed, and front-facing. Encourage attendees to use a recent reference photo if your flow supports it.

Keep expectations realistic. Not every frame will include a perfect facial angle, especially in candid shots. A good platform should still surface strong probable matches and make manual refinement easy.

Privacy and trust matter. Clearly communicate how search works, how long data is retained, and how users can request removal. Transparent communication improves adoption and confidence.

Common Mistakes That Slow Photo Discovery

A common mistake is uploading every frame without curation. Duplicate and low-quality shots create noise and lower trust in search results.

Another issue is weak event naming. If an event title is unclear, people may not even enter the right gallery before searching. Naming should include event type, date, and location context when possible.

Finally, avoid burying your search action behind multiple clicks. If users cannot quickly find where to start, they leave. Prominent calls to action and simple entry points are essential.
